Andrew J M Boulton
Andrew J M Boulton is Professor of Medicine at the Universities of Manchester and Miami, Florida, and Consultant Physician, Manchester Royal Infirmary. Professor Boulton has authored more than 350 peer-reviewed manuscripts and book chapters, mainly on diabetic neuropathy and foot complications. He was the principal invited lecturer at the launch of the American Diabetes Association (ADA) Foot Care Council. Among his many awards, his contribution to worldwide care of the diabetic foot was honored by receiving the American Diabetes Association (ADA) Roger Pecoraro Lectureship and the European Association for the Study of Diabetes (EASD) Camillo Golgi prize and was the first recipient of the international award on diabetic foot research. He was the founding Chairman of the Diabetic Foot Study Group was previously Chairman of Postgraduate Education and then program chair for the EASD. Professor Boulton graduated (with honours) from the University of Newcastle-upon-Tyne Medical School. He was subsequently a research fellow under Professor JD Ward in Sheffield.
